Sometimes when I start my system, the Isis Client Manager comes up empty - no Isis workspace to log into. The only solution I've found is to restart the computer.
Is there a quicker way to get the Client Mgr to see the Isis? I've tried quitting the manager and restarting the program, but that doesn't work. Network connections are working. Isis is on.
